Block
#13,166,363
14w
20 txs425,943 confs
Transactions
20
Total Output
₳4,623,961.07
$662.38K
Fees
₳5.21
Size
25.04 KB
25,644 bytes
Details
Hash
f3841efa1fb28e97d05ab0f840215b7b61cd63456405c1083dfdb7cb5a99268c
Epoch / Slot
Epoch 619 · slot 182,096,937 · epoch-slot 52,137
Timestamp
14w · Mon, 16 Mar 2026 12:13:48 GMT
Block producer
VRF key
vrf_vk1z…hs5775xh
Op cert
92c80a00…9614b9fd
Op cert counter
1659973850
Transactions in block20